Norton 360 V3 ccSvCHst uses 99% of CPU time, won't stop doing "background tasks"

Norton 360 V3.0.0.135 pops up "Norton 360 is performing background tasks", then never finishes doing the background task(s), and when I try to use the PC the ccSvcHst.exe process for user SYSTEM (I'm not logged in as System) will be using 97-100% of CPU time, which makes the system essentally un-usable due to sluggishness. It never (even waiting overnight) comes out of this state. Rebooting "solves" the problem temporarily, and the system is back to normal, until hours later when N360 is idle it goes back into this sate and ccSVCHst.exe/SYSTEM again uses all CPU time...

 

Task Manager shows that 75% of the total CPU usage is in the kernell

 

System is Win XP SP3, 1 GB RAM, Lot of free disk space, system otherwise healthy and well maintained. Windows Live Family security uninstalled (a suggestion by customer service), Malwarebytes shows the system is clean. I do have nVidea video board (one post I saw speculated it was problematic) w/ latest drivers.

 

I have N360 running on 2 other Win XP PC's just fine w/ no complaints. So there is some conflict w/ other s/w on this one PC I need to find....

 

This problem has persisted for a month since I upgraded from NIS 2008. I've run BUdump.exe, and run Norton Removal Tool w/ reobtts 3 times before reinstalling 360. And then I've repeated the BUdump/removal tool/ cleann re-install of 360 at least 3 times but the problem persists. No other Norton products installed (although many old version were in the past).

 

The only hint I  have is the 360 CPU usage window will nearly always show "Norton Insight Scan" in ORANGE color when this happens. The last run date will be "old" (i.e., 24 hours, etc), Run during Idle = yes, and Status usually RUNNING. Its as if Insight scan is running but not really totally completed? I can run a manual insite scan to completion OK.

 

I've basically turned off every N360 task scheduling, shut down unneeded startup items & processes, Norton community, etc.Still it persists. I just wish I could somhow disable [registry key, etc] N360 from running ANY background tasks but customer service says this can't be done.
